I work in East Palo Alto, California, teaching third grade. Close to 90% of our mostly Hispanic and African-American student population qualifies for the free and reduced price lunch program. One of my students' great joys in school is going on field trips. The majority of our families face economic challenges on a daily basis. Going to museums, musicals, and the zoo are expenses they usually can't afford. This is why I feel it is essential that I can provide opportunities for my students to see life outside of our classroom walls. I want them to experience the things they learn about in school. Habitats is one of the most popular third grade science units. Kids love learning about rain forests, deserts, the arctic, grasslands, and the ocean. I would be thrilled if I could take my students on a journey to one of the habitats, the ocean, by visiting the Monterey Bay Aquarium. The Monterey Bay Aquarium is truly a magical place for children. I want to see their eyes light up when they see in person a sea creature that they've read about. I have already secured tickets for the field trip for my class and the other five 3rd grade classrooms (120 students in all). We have June 9th reserved but we need help in paying for three buses to get us there! We have been fundraising all year but are still short. We are asking for the funds to pay the balance needed on the transportation costs. My students and I appreciate your help!
